Jquery
20 Plugins para jQuery
201. MeioMask - Até agora, pra mim este é o melhor plugin para mascarar inputs.
02. jQuery image zoom effect – De apelo visual, este plugin é útil quando bem usado.
03. Password – Ele monitora e exibe a força da senha digitada. Dentre os que pesquisei, achei este o mais simples.
04. Slide Simples – Slide simples de foto. Sugiro usar este para estudo. É muito simples fazer um desses. Aprenda a usar e aplique outros locais.
05. Crop com Upload – Permite enviar uma imagem e aparecer aquele recurso de cortar a foto, semelhante ao Orkut.
06. jBar – Mostra uma barra de notificação, semelhante ao que o Twitter está usando
07. Crop com upload (2) – Corta a imagem, faz upload e permite fazer mais algumas alterações na imagem.
08. jMaxInput – Plugin que permite mostrar a quantidade de caracteres digitado e ainda validar caso não tenha preenchido.
09. jPaginate – De apelo visual e muito divertido, este plugin dá um efeito de transição na paginação.
10. jTextTranslate – Utiliza a API do google para traduzir os textos selecionados. Muito interessante.
11. Jqtransform – Transforma um formulário comum para um layout mais agradável.
12. Chromatable – Monta uma tabela com os dados informados.
13. Password Strength – Mostra força da senha, mas este exibe o tempo aproximado que sua senha pode ser descoberta.
14. Scroll Menu – De grande apelo visual, este plugin deixa seu menu bem louco. É divertido.
15. MB.MENU – Para quem gosta de colocar firulas no menu.
É um plugin meio pesado, mas para quem for fazer bom uso dele, vale o carregamento.
16. Fancy Player – Exiba vídeos com mais estilo. Este plugin garante a boa aparência.
17. Flickr Menu 2 – Estilo de menu imitando o Flickr.
18. SlideShow – Gosto muito deste. É simples e apresenta slides de uma forma bem formal.
19. iToggle – Plugin bem original, que exibe um interruptor on/off.
E como nota, a empresa Engage Interactive arrebenta com interação. Navegue no site deles e aproveite para conheça seu laboratório.
20. Playlist Youtube – Exiba uma playlist do youtube com o jQuery.
Mais plugins:
Update (02/09/2010) – Devido ao alta quantidade de acessos nesta página, verifiquei os links dos plugins e corrigi alguns.
Jquery – Deixando suas animações mais profissionais
2Vou deixar uma dica bem rápida e simples para você aperfeiçoar suas animações.
Sabe quando uma determinada imagem tem o efeito de zoom, e se você clicar dezenas de vezes por segundo na imagem, a animação vai continuar acontecendo, mesmo depois de você ter parado de clicar.
Exemplo:
[sourcecode language='javascript']

[/sourcecode]
Para evitar isso é muito simples, basta encadear a função Stop no animate. Veja a modificação do script acima.
[sourcecode language='javascript']

[/sourcecode]
Simples, não?
Receio que muita gente questionava este problema ao usar jQuery.
Sugestão: Você pode usar esta técnica emoutras ocasiões, alias, ela vai ser muito mais útil agora que você a conhece.
Para quem não compreendeu, convido a dar uma lida na documentação do animate:
14 ótimos plugins para jQuery
1Plugin com diversos recursos para manipular completamente um grid em tabela, é possível ordenar, buscar, limitar entre outros. São recursos incríveis, veja neste link: http://trirand.com/jqgrid/jqgrid.html
Bacana para montar pequenos e médios gráficos em suas aplicações. Ele gera de forma muito simples, bastando informar poucos parâmetros em array.
Um dos mais recomendados plugins para upload de arquivos jQuery. Ele pode parecer meio complexo de inicio, mas o aprendizado é válido.
Plugin jQuery bacana para usar janelas modal, box de avisos, box com formulários via ajax entre outros. Plugin bem flexível.
qTip já é um consagrado da Craig Thompson’s. Não é viável o uso em qualquer projeto, mas vale cohecê-lo, pois um dia você vai precisar.
Incrivelmente útil este efeito de mascarar um input de formulário. Com a versalidade do mesmo, você pode mascarar em qualquer padrão.
Com esse nome criativo, o plugin dá conta de fazer buscas. Ele busca dados em um array e mostra comente os relacionados. É interessante. Mas se você quiser fazer buscas dentro de uma tabela, prefira o Grid Plugin.
Interessante para aplicar o recurso de Sort nas colunas na tabela. É aquele efeito que ordena determinada coluna da tabela. Plugin dispensável caso esteja usando o Grid Plugin.
Curioso efeito de zoom. Eu usava ele em versão prototype, mas desde que me converti para jQuery, passei a procurar plugins que antes usava em prototype, agora em jQuery e esse não foi diferente. É um plugin idêntico, se não melhor. Este plugin costuma agradar muito.
Este plugin incrível permite executar arquivos MP3 e Ogg. Permite usar playlist. O mais incrível é que o layout dele é customizavel por css.
Um dos melhores plugins que já usei para jQuery, tanto é que já estou escrevendo um artigo especial para este plugin, com tutorial e tudo. Ele é simplesmente fantástico, embora tenha uma documentação fraca.
Para os amantes de Cakephp, logo irei publicar um helper para este plugin.
Plugin interessante e pode ser útil às vezes. Ele posiciona o background da sua página de acordo com a resolução do usuário. Ele centraliza o posicionamento não só do background, mas dos elementos que você configurar.
Excelente plugin para uma galeria de fotos ou conjunto de imagens. Versátil e diferente.
É um efeito bacana e não é difícil se fazer sem o plugin, mas a idéia é válida.
Esses nomes de plugins estão cada vez mais criativos. Este é apenas um slide. A diferença dele é o tipo de animação. Se você não reparou, ao deslizar ele vai devagar e acelera rapidamente, isso é bem legal.
Carregar Jquery do servidor do Google
0Há três motivos para você adotar esta sugestão:
#1 – Economia de banda em seu servidor, pois sempre que seu site for carregado, o script será puxado dos servidores do Google e não do seu.
#2 – É bem mais rápido adicionar um link do que baixar a ultima versão do jQuery e salvar na raiz do seu site.
#3 – Você sempre estará com a versão nova do jQuery.
Como fazer isso? (Você pode escolher a versão a ser usada também)
Modo mais simples e mais utilizado:
[sourcecode language='javascript']
[/sourcecode]
Para quem usa Cakephp, basta fazer assim:
[sourcecode language='php']
< ?=$javascript->link(‘http://ajax.googleapis.com/ajax/libs/jquery/1.3/jquery.min.js’, false);?> [/sourcecode]
Modo ApiGoogle:
Com a Api de bibliotecas do Google você pode fazer o mesmo para outros frameworks Javascripts como: jQuery, jQuery UI, Prototype, script.aculo.us, MooTools, Dojo, SWFObject e Yahoo! User Interface Library.
Outra característica é que você pode especificar a versão que deseja utilizar e se deseja que ela seja carregada “comprimida” ou não, exemplo:
[sourcecode language='javascript']
google.load(“jquery”, “1.3″, {uncompressed:true})
[/sourcecode]
25 boas práticas para jquery
0
Exelentes dicas para jquery, altamente recomendável.
Link: http://pomoti.com/excelentes-truques-e-dicas-para-jquery
40 plugins para jquery
0Encontrei uma ótima lista de plugins para jQuery, confira a baixo:
1. Interface ~ opções para movimentar divs, mudar tamanhos, criar slideshows, auto-completar, criar carrinho de compras e outras coisas.
2. jQuery Flash Plugin ~ “simples, mas poderoso” ~ detecta se o Flash está instalado, pede para instalar, é acessível e não obstrusivo! Possui códigos legais feitos com ele como inserir um mp3 player em Flash e vídeos do YouTube.
3. TableSorter ~ permite que o usuário edite a ordem dos dados de tabelas sem precisar recarregar a página.
4. jQMinMax ~ adiciona suporte a min-width, max-width, min-height e max-height onde eles não são suportados.
5. QuickSearch ~ plugin não-obstrusivo que busca textos e possui várias opções.
6. Tabs version 2 ~ sistema de abas com diversos efeitos.
7. autocomplete ~ faça sistemas de autocompletar facilmente com esse plugin.
8. autohelp ~ ajuda o usuário a preencher formulários dando dicas do que escrever.
9. editable ~ edite elementos com um click.
10. AutoScroll ~ segure Control e mova o mouse para rolar a página.
11. jQuery History ~ grave o histórico e ative a opção de voltar no navegador.
12. CheckBox ~ mude as checkboxes de seus formulários com esse plugin e CSS.
13. Chili ~ colore a sintaxe de códigos de diversas linguagens com CSS.
14. ColorGradient ~ cria gradient em elementos com as cores selecionadas.
15. Gradient ~ cria efeito gradient no fundo de elementos.
16. Curvy Corners ~ adicione bordas arredondadas em elementos facilmente. Sem Photoshop!
17. GreyBox Redux ~ mostre fotos, sites e outras coisas em uma janela no estilo LightBox.
18. jCarousel ~ controla listas verticais e horizontais com conteúdo dinâmico ou estático e com animação.
19. jScrollPane ~ mude a aparência das scrollbars.
20. MouseGestures ~ identifique os movimentos do mouse.
21. jTicker ~ faz com que uma div rode notícias vindas de um arquivo RSS.
22. ToolTip ~ cria as famosas tooltips. Aquelas janelinhas que aparecem quando você passa o mouse em algo.
23. NiceJForms ~ deixe seus formulários mais belos.
24. Ajax Queue ~ faça filas para carregar páginas.
25. pngFix ~ corrige o velho problema do PNG transparente no IEca 5.5 e 6.
26. jQuery Accessibility Plugin ~ torna seu site acessível facilmente.
27. jTemplates ~ cria templates facilmente 100% JavaScript.
28. jqUploader ~ substitui campos input por um arquivo Flash que mostra a porcentagem e barra de progresso dos uploads.
29. jTagEditor ~ cria editores de códigos HTMl, sintaxe Wiki, BBCode e outras coisas.
30. jQuery Grid ~ solução para representar dados em tabelas.
31. jdMenu ~ cria menus dropdown facilmente.
32. DynaCloud ~ cria tags cloud de textos e os colore quando clicados.
33. FlyDOM ~ gera conteúdo dinamica e facilmente.
34. jQuery UI ~ crie interfaces para o usuário facilmente com esse plugin.
35. BlockUI ~ mostra uma mensagem de espera no centro da tela enquanto executa alguma operação AJAX.
36. jQuery Calendar ~ cria um calendário quando o usuário clica em um campo de texto de formulário.
37. jqModal ~ crie diversos tipos de janelas com HTML e CSS.
38. Impromptu ~ crie diversos tipos de mensagem de confirmação.
39. Password Strenght Meter ~ use-o para medir se uma senha é fácil ou difícil.
40. Multiple File Upload ~ permite upload de múltiplos arquivos com filtro de extensões e número máximo de arquivos.
Lista feita por Pedro Menezes.
10 boas práticas para programar em Jquery
0
Recebi uma notificação do Google Alert sobre jquery, fui de blog em blog e acabei parando em um artigo muito interessante e extremamente útil, mesmo para quem já é féra em Jquery.
Confira neste link: http://www.myinkblog.com/2009/08/04/10-tips-for-writing-better-jquery-code/
![(jquery) [bb]](http://www.renanlima.com/blog/wp-content/uploads/2009/10/JQuery_logo_color_onwhite.png)

Comentários recentes